Tar roof repair services involve addressing issues related to flat or low-slope roofs covered with tar-based materials, such as built-up roofing (BUR) systems or modified bitumen. These services typically include patching leaks, sealing cracks, replacing damaged sections, and restoring the overall integrity of the roof surface. Skilled contractors assess the extent of damage, remove deteriorated layers, and apply new tar or asphalt-based materials to ensure a durable, weather-resistant roof. Proper repair can extend the lifespan of the roofing system and help maintain the property's protection against water intrusion.
One of the primary problems tar roof repair services aim to solve is roof leaks caused by aging materials, weather exposure, or physical damage. Over time, tar roofs may develop cracks, blisters, or punctures that compromise their waterproofing capabilities. Repairing these issues promptly prevents water from seeping into the building, which can lead to structural damage, mold growth, and interior water stains. Additionally, tar roof repairs can address issues caused by standing water or poor drainage, which can accelerate deterioration and weaken the roof's surface.

Professional tar roof repair providers typically evaluate the condition of the existing roofing system, identify areas of concern, and perform targeted repairs to restore waterproofing and structural stability. The repair process may involve cleaning the surface, removing loose or damaged material, and applying new layers of tar or asphalt-based compounds. Skilled contractors use appropriate techniques and materials to ensure that the repaired sections blend seamlessly with the existing roof and provide long-lasting protection. Cost Range for Tar Roof Repairs - The typical cost for repairing a tar roof varies from approximately $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and repair complexity. Minor patch-ups tend to be on the lower end, while extensive repairs can approach higher figures.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ific roof conditions.
Factors Influencing Repair Costs - The size of the damaged area and the roof’s overall condition significantly impact the repair expenses. Smaller repairs might cost around $300-$600, whereas larger or more involved projects can range up to $1,200 or more. Contact local contractors for tailored quotes.
Average Cost per Square Foot - Repair costs for tar roofs typically fall between $2 and $4 per square foot, depending on the repair type and materials used. For example, a 10-foot by 10-foot patch might cost between $200 and $400. Local service providers can assess specific needs for accurate pricing.

How do I know if my tar roof needs repairs? Signs such as visible cracks, blistering, or pooling water can indicate the need for repairs. It’s advisable to have a professional inspection to assess the condition accurately.
What types of damage can be repaired on a tar roof? Common issues like cracks, splits, blisters, and minor leaks can typically be repaired by local roofing contractors specializing in tar roof services.
How long do tar roof repairs usually take? Repair durations vary depending on the extent of damage, but most minor repairs can be completed within a day by experienced service providers.
Are tar roof repairs a temporary or permanent solution? Repairs can extend the life of a tar roof, but ongoing maintenance or a full replacement may be recommended for long-term durability.
